Bill Summary
AN ACT TO CREATE THE FAMILIES' RIGHTS AND RESPONSIBILITIES ACT; AND FOR OTHER PURPOSES.
AI Summary
This bill creates the Families' Rights and Responsibilities Act, which establishes robust legal protections for parental rights in Arkansas. The legislation defines a parent's fundamental right to care, custody, and control of their child, including decisions about education, healthcare, religious training, and upbringing. The bill mandates that any government action that substantially burdens these parental rights must meet a strict scrutiny standard, meaning the government must prove that its action is essential to further a compelling governmental interest and is the least restrictive means of doing so. The bill provides parents with specific rights, such as accessing their child's medical and educational records, consenting to biometric data collection, choosing educational options, making healthcare decisions, and being notified of potential child safety issues. Parents are also given legal remedies if their rights are violated, including the ability to seek declaratory relief, injunctions, compensatory damages, and attorney's fees. The legislation explicitly does not protect actions that would constitute child abuse or neglect and emphasizes that these protections are in addition to existing constitutional and legal safeguards. The bill applies to all current and future state laws and is designed to broadly protect parental rights to the maximum extent permitted by state and federal constitutions.
